Abstract
The invention relates to a device for scanning still images as applicable in particular to high-definition television (HDTV) systems. In accordance with customary practice, the entire still image is converted by an optical system having an oscillating mirror to an image which passes in front of a linear sensor having photosensitive elements. Diffusion of the optical system causes detachment of dark areas which are adjacent to bright areas. In order to prevent this detachment, the movement of a shutter provided with slits is synchronized with the movement of the mirror so as to occult part of the image which passes in front of the sensor, thus leaving only the zone located at the level of the sensor.
